Executive Summary
SaaS leaders rarely struggle because demand is weak. They struggle because growth changes the operating model faster than the platform evolves. What works for one product, one segment, or one pricing model often breaks when the business adds enterprise accounts, channel partners, embedded software use cases, regional compliance requirements, or white-label delivery. Multi-tenant platform operations sit at the center of that transition. They determine whether the company can scale recurring revenue efficiently, protect margins, maintain service quality, and support differentiated go-to-market motions without creating operational sprawl.
The core decision is not simply multi-tenant versus dedicated cloud architecture. The real executive question is how to align architecture, service operations, billing, governance, customer lifecycle management, and partner enablement to the segments the business intends to serve. A well-run multi-tenant model can accelerate onboarding, standardize upgrades, improve observability, and lower cost-to-serve. A poorly governed one can increase risk concentration, complicate tenant isolation, and create friction for enterprise buyers who need stronger controls. The right answer is usually a segmented operating model with clear rules for when to standardize, when to isolate, and when to offer managed exceptions.
Why platform operations become a board-level issue during segment expansion
As SaaS companies move upmarket or broaden into new channels, platform operations become a strategic lever rather than a back-office function. Enterprise customers expect governance, security, compliance alignment, identity and access management, auditability, and predictable service levels. Mid-market customers expect speed, packaged value, and low-friction onboarding. Partners such as ERP firms, MSPs, ISVs, and system integrators expect reusable delivery patterns, API-first architecture, and commercial flexibility. If the operating model cannot support all three, growth across segments becomes expensive and inconsistent.
This is why recurring revenue strategy must be tied directly to platform design. Subscription business models depend on retention, expansion, and efficient service delivery over time. Platform operations influence all three. They shape how quickly new tenants are provisioned, how upgrades are rolled out, how incidents are contained, how usage is measured, how billing automation is enforced, and how customer success teams intervene before churn risk becomes visible in revenue reports.
A practical decision framework for choosing the right operating model
| Business condition | Operational priority | Recommended model | Primary trade-off |
|---|---|---|---|
| High-volume SMB or mid-market growth | Speed, standardization, low cost-to-serve | Shared multi-tenant platform | Less room for bespoke controls |
| Enterprise accounts with strict isolation or regulatory requirements | Control, auditability, segmentation | Dedicated cloud architecture or logically isolated premium tier | Higher delivery and support cost |
| Partner-led white-label SaaS or OEM platform strategy | Brand flexibility, reusable provisioning, delegated administration | Multi-tenant core with partner-level governance layers | More complex entitlement and billing design |
| Embedded software inside another product or workflow | API reliability, integration consistency, lifecycle versioning | API-first multi-tenant platform with service boundaries | Greater engineering discipline required |
The most resilient SaaS businesses avoid ideological architecture decisions. They define service tiers based on revenue potential, compliance needs, support expectations, and partner economics. Multi-tenant architecture should be the default where standardization creates margin and speed. Dedicated cloud architecture should be a deliberate exception for accounts or segments where isolation, data residency, or contractual controls justify the premium.
How multi-tenant operations support subscription business models and recurring revenue
Subscription businesses win when they reduce friction across the customer lifecycle. That starts with SaaS onboarding, but it extends into adoption, expansion, renewal, and customer success. Multi-tenant platform operations support this by making provisioning repeatable, feature delivery consistent, and service telemetry visible across the installed base. Leaders can identify which segments adopt quickly, which integrations delay time-to-value, and which usage patterns correlate with churn reduction or expansion.
This matters even more in partner ecosystems. A white-label SaaS or OEM platform strategy often depends on the ability to launch many branded tenant environments without rebuilding the product or support model each time. The platform must separate what is configurable from what is governed centrally. Branding, packaging, entitlements, billing relationships, and delegated administration may vary by partner, but security baselines, release management, observability, and resilience should remain centrally controlled.
- Use packaging and entitlement rules to align product access with segment-specific pricing and support tiers.
- Connect billing automation to tenant lifecycle events so upgrades, downgrades, trials, and renewals do not rely on manual operations.
- Instrument onboarding milestones and product usage so customer success teams can intervene before adoption stalls.
- Design partner-facing administration carefully to enable autonomy without weakening governance or tenant isolation.
What architecture choices matter most when growth spans segments
Architecture should be evaluated by business outcome, not technical fashion. Cloud-native infrastructure, Kubernetes, Docker, PostgreSQL, Redis, and workflow automation can all be relevant, but only when they improve scalability, resilience, deployment consistency, or operational efficiency. The executive lens is simpler: can the platform support more tenants, more integrations, more usage variability, and more service expectations without linear cost growth?
For many SaaS providers, the answer lies in a modular platform engineering approach. Core shared services such as identity, billing, monitoring, audit logging, and configuration management should be standardized. Workloads with different performance or compliance profiles should be isolated at the service, data, or environment layer as needed. API-first architecture is especially important because segment expansion almost always increases integration demands. ERP partners, MSPs, and enterprise buyers do not want a closed application. They want a platform that fits into broader digital transformation programs.
Multi-tenant versus dedicated cloud architecture is a portfolio decision
A common mistake is treating dedicated environments as a premium feature rather than an operating model with real cost implications. Dedicated cloud architecture can improve customer confidence, simplify certain compliance conversations, and support custom integration or performance requirements. But it also increases deployment complexity, patching overhead, release coordination, and support variance. Multi-tenant architecture, by contrast, improves standardization and release velocity but requires stronger tenant isolation, governance, and noisy-neighbor controls.
| Dimension | Multi-tenant architecture | Dedicated cloud architecture |
|---|---|---|
| Unit economics | Better margin potential through shared services | Higher cost-to-serve per customer |
| Release management | Centralized and faster | More fragmented and customer-specific |
| Enterprise sales fit | Strong when controls are mature and well-documented | Strong when buyers require visible isolation |
| Operational complexity | Higher governance discipline inside one platform | Higher environment sprawl across many deployments |
| Partner scale | Well suited for white-label and OEM replication | Useful for select strategic accounts only |
Which operational controls protect growth without slowing it down
The fastest-growing SaaS companies eventually discover that scale problems are often control problems. Governance, security, compliance alignment, observability, and operational resilience are not separate workstreams. They are the operating system of a scalable platform. Tenant isolation must be designed and tested continuously. Identity and access management must support internal teams, customers, and partners with clear role boundaries. Monitoring should move beyond infrastructure health to include tenant experience, integration failures, billing exceptions, and onboarding bottlenecks.
Operational resilience also deserves executive attention. Segment growth increases blast radius if incidents are not contained. Shared platforms need clear service boundaries, rollback discipline, dependency mapping, and incident communication processes that reflect customer and partner expectations. How to build an implementation roadmap that aligns technology with revenue goals
Implementation should begin with segmentation, not tooling. Leaders should define which customer and partner segments matter most over the next 12 to 24 months, what service expectations each segment has, and which revenue motions depend on platform flexibility. Only then should the company decide where to invest in platform engineering, automation, and managed operations.
- Phase 1: Establish the target operating model. Define segment tiers, support models, isolation policies, pricing dependencies, and partner requirements.
- Phase 2: Standardize the platform core. Consolidate identity, provisioning, billing automation, monitoring, auditability, and release management.
- Phase 3: Introduce controlled segmentation. Add premium isolation options, partner administration layers, and integration patterns for enterprise workflows.
- Phase 4: Operationalize customer lifecycle management. Connect onboarding, adoption telemetry, customer success, and renewal signals to platform data.
- Phase 5: Prepare for AI-ready SaaS platforms. Improve data quality, event consistency, access controls, and service observability so future AI capabilities are trustworthy and governable.
This roadmap helps avoid a common trap: overbuilding infrastructure before the commercial model is clear. Platform maturity should follow revenue strategy. If the business is expanding through channel partners, partner provisioning and delegated governance may matter more than advanced customization. If the business is moving upmarket, auditability, tenant isolation, and integration reliability may deserve priority over broad feature expansion.
Common mistakes SaaS leaders make when scaling across segments
The first mistake is allowing one large customer to define the platform roadmap for everyone else. This often leads to bespoke architecture, fragmented releases, and rising support costs that undermine recurring revenue quality. The second is underestimating the operational implications of white-label SaaS, OEM platform strategy, or embedded software. These models can expand reach quickly, but they require disciplined entitlement management, partner governance, and integration lifecycle control.
Another frequent mistake is separating customer success from platform operations. Churn reduction is not only a relationship issue. It is often a provisioning issue, an integration issue, a performance issue, or a billing issue. When customer lifecycle management data is disconnected from operational telemetry, leaders miss the early signals that matter most. Finally, many firms invest in cloud-native infrastructure without defining service ownership, observability standards, or resilience objectives. Tools alone do not create enterprise scalability.
How to evaluate ROI and risk in multi-tenant platform operations
Business ROI should be measured through operating leverage, not just infrastructure savings. The strongest indicators include faster tenant onboarding, lower manual support effort, more predictable release cycles, improved partner launch readiness, reduced billing leakage, stronger renewal confidence, and better expansion capacity across segments. These outcomes improve gross margin quality and make recurring revenue more durable.
Risk mitigation should be assessed in parallel. Leaders should ask whether the platform can contain incidents by tenant or service boundary, whether governance scales with partner access, whether compliance obligations are visible early in the sales cycle, and whether premium isolation options exist for strategic accounts. The goal is not zero risk. The goal is controlled, transparent risk that supports growth rather than surprising the business after contracts are signed.
Future trends shaping the next generation of SaaS platform operations
Over the next several years, SaaS platform operations will be shaped by three converging forces. First, buyers will expect more configurable delivery models, including shared multi-tenant, logically isolated premium tiers, and dedicated options for select workloads. Second, AI-ready SaaS platforms will require stronger data governance, event consistency, and access controls because automation and intelligence are only as reliable as the operational foundation beneath them. Third, partner ecosystems will become more important as software vendors seek efficient distribution through MSPs, ERP partners, consultants, and embedded channels.
This creates an opportunity for SaaS leaders who think in platforms rather than products. The winners will not be the companies with the most infrastructure. They will be the ones with the clearest operating model, the best alignment between architecture and commercial strategy, and the strongest ability to support multiple segments without multiplying complexity.
